尊旭网
当前位置: 尊旭网 > 知识 >

8255

时间:2025-01-03 18:20:03 编辑:阿旭

8255A有几种工作方式?

8255 有三种工作方式\x0d\x0a \x0d\x0a方式0(基本输入输出方式):\x0d\x0a不需任何选通信号,A口、B口、高半C口、低半C口,者可被设定为输入或输出。\x0d\x0a作输出口时输出数据存锁;作输入口时输入数据不存锁。\x0d\x0a \x0d\x0a方式1(选通输入输出方式):\x0d\x0aA、B、C 三个口分为两组。\x0d\x0aA组包括A口及高半C口,A口可编程设定为输入或输出,高半C口作I/O控制及同步信号;\x0d\x0aB组包括B口及低半C口,B口可编程设定为输入或输出,低半C口作I/O控制及同步信号;\x0d\x0aA口、B口的输入/输出数据都被存锁。\x0d\x0a \x0d\x0a方式2(双向总线方式):\x0d\x0aA口(仅A口)作8位双向总线,C口的PC3~PC7位用作I/O控制及同步信号;\x0d\x0aB口及C口的PC0~PC2可编程设定为方式0或方式1工作。


8255A的A口有几种工作方式

8255A的A口有3种工作方式:方式0、方式1、方式2。1、方式0(基本输入输出方式):不需任何选通信号,A口、B口、C口高4位、C口低位,都可被设定为输入或输出。作输出口时输出数据存锁;作输入口时输入数据不存锁。2、方式1(选通输入输出方式):A、B、C 三个口分为两组。A组:包括A口及高半C口,A口可编程设定为输入或输出,C口高4位作I/O控制及同步信号;B组:包括B口及低半C口,B口可编程设定为输入或输出,C口低4位作I/O控制及同步信号;A口、B口的输入/输出数据都被存锁。3、方式2(双向总线方式):A口(仅A口)作8位双向总线,C口的PC3~PC7位用于I/O控制及同步信号;B口及C口的PC0~PC2位,可编程设定为方式0或方式1工作。性能分析8255A芯片 Intel 8086/8088 系列的可编程外设接口电路(Programmable Peripheral Interface)简称 PPI,型号为8255(改进型为8255A及8255A-5)。具有24条输入/输出引脚、可编程的通用并行输入/输出接口电路。它是一片使用单一+5V电源的40脚双列直插式大规模集成电路。